**Ticket QUOTA-418: quota-sync creds expired again**

Heads up, future folks: the Quotaloom service account that syncs per-tenant rate quotas into Fencible lapsed over the weekend, so tenant limits froze at stale values. Nobody got throttled correctly and the Brennock team noticed. I've minted a fresh key with a 90-day TTL — please set a calendar nudge this time. New key for quota-sync is below.

API key for kahop-bagef: zpat2_yb

Ticket: Config drift between Dunmere regions on date localization. The Fablewright API should format dates per the requesting locale, but eu-west still emits US-style dates because its formatter overrides were never updated after the Q2 rollout. Users in the Veldoria market have filed three complaints. Root cause is a manual hotfix that was never backported to the config repo. Proposing we reconcile at the sync and redeploy. For reference, the intended canonical values are:

deployment values, kajep-kageg:
[praix]
host = praix.paliqcorp.corp
user = praix_svc
database = praix_prod

Ticket PAY-4412: Vault lockout blocking idempotency key rotation

The Ledgerfen vault sealed itself after three failed unseal attempts, blocking rotation of the idempotency keys used by the Tollgate payment retry service. Until resolved, retries risk duplicate charges, so the retry worker is paused. For the weekly eng sync: manual unseal is approved, using the recovery passphrase below.

recovery phrase for fajeg-hagug: holox-fenmir